Things to consider
Higher = more presentNo sexual content is present in this book.
Mild peril and chase scenes occur during Nancy's investigation.
No profanity is present in this book.
No blasphemy is present in this book.
No substance use is present in this book.
No suicide or self-harm themes are present in this book.
Some suspenseful moments and mild scares are present.
No occult or witchcraft themes are present in this book.
No LGBTQ+ themes are present in this book.
The worldview is generally positive and focuses on problem-solving.
No negative portrayals of Christians are present in this book.
Virtues to celebrate
Higher = stronger presenceNancy shows courage in facing dangerous situations.
No explicit Christian faith elements are present.
Friendship and loyalty are demonstrated between characters.
No themes of grace or repentance are central.
